Job Purpose: To act as a positive role model and be responsible for delivering and implementing a high quality play based curriculum under the guidance of the national quality frameworks Aistear and Solta both indoors and outdoors. To guide, observe, stimulate and supervise children in a safe and caring environment as part of the childcare team. Core Duties & Responsibilities: To work within the ethos, aims, and objectives of Respond. To promote and adhere to the services ethos and mission of Respond. To follow the policies and procedures of the service at all times. To conduct observation and learning stories for all children. Organise materials and resources to ensure that they reflect the childrens emerging interests and abilities. To implement a play based curriculum that encourages independence and fosters the growth of self esteem within all children. To support childrens emotional, social and cognitive development. To assist in providing healthy snacks that meet children's growing needs and reflect variations in culture or dietary requirements. To develop and support parental involvement strategies that enhance childrens learning experiences. Participate in reviews and evaluations of the service along with other staff and management. Provide ongoing support to all staff members, in relation to work time management and training needs. Undertake any other relevant tasks as may be required from time to time. Person Specification: Excellent communication and interpersonal skills. Strong Leadership qualities The ability to work in collaboration with a dedicated team Highly motivated to work on own initiative A professional and enthusiastic disposition Aptitude and empathy with children and families Commitment to high quality Education and Care Flexible and adaptable Commitment to continuous professional development Change management skills Analytical skills Qualification & Experience: A FETAC Level 7 qualification in Early Childhood Care and Education is essential A number of years of experience working in an Early Years setting is essential A minimum two years of experience in a supervisory role is essential Closing Date: Friday 7th November 2025.
